3FP4 Transport Protein date Jan 03, 2009
title Crystal Structure Of Tom71 Complexed With Ssa1 C-Terminal Fr
authors J.Li, X.Qian, J.Hu, B.Sha
compound source
Molecule: Tpr Repeat-Containing Protein Yhr117w
Chain: A
Fragment: Unp Residues 107-639
Engineered: Yes
Organism_scientific: Saccharomyces Cerevisiae
Organism_common: Yeast
Organism_taxid: 4932
Gene: Yhr117w
Expression_system: Escherichia Coli
Expression_system_taxid: 562

Molecule: Ssa1
Chain: Q
Engineered: Yes

Synthetic: Yes
Other_details: This Sequence Occurs Naturally In Yeast.
symmetry Space Group: P 21 21 21
R_factor 0.208 R_Free 0.261
crystal
cell
length a length b length c angle alpha angle beta angle gamma
47.820 116.025 150.649 90.00 90.00 90.00
method X-Ray Diffractionresolution 2.14 Å
ligand CL, NA, SO4 enzyme
Primary referenceMolecular chaperone Hsp70/Hsp90 prepares the mitochondrial outer membrane translocon receptor Tom71 for preprotein loading., Li J, Qian X, Hu J, Sha B, J Biol Chem. 2009 Aug 28;284(35):23852-9. Epub 2009 Jul 6. PMID:19581297
